I.N.D.I.A bloc, NDA lock horns over Dumri assembly seat

Monday, 04 September 2023 | PNS | Ranchi

Campaigning for the September 5 bypolls to Dumri assembly seat ended on Sunday with I.N.D.I.A bloc candidate Bebi Devi locked in a direct contest with NDA candidate Yashoda Devi.

The seat has turned out to be a prestigious one for both alliances amid Jharkhand Mukti Morcha (JMM) claiming that the I.N.D.I.A bloc will begin its victory journey from Dumri, while the NDA exuded confidence that it is all set to snatch the seat from JMM.

On last day of campaigning on Sunday, State Chief Minister Hemant Soren took part in the road show seeking votes for JMM candidate, while at the same time AJSU chief Sudesh Mahto too addressed public meetings.

The bypoll was necessitated following the death of JMM MLA Jagarnath Mahto, former education minister, in April. Mahto had been representing the seat since 2004. The JMM has fielded Mahto's wife Bebi Devi as the I.N.D.I.A bloc nominee, while AJSU Party has fielded Yashoda Devi. Though, Yashoda Devi is AJSU party candidate, BJP leadership including state president Babulal Marandi has put his strength in the bypoll. The bypoll will also be the test of Marandi popularity as Dumri will be the first bypoll after Marandi was appointed as State BJP president.

BJP State President and former Chief Minister Babulal Marandi has addressed several public meetings in the constituency seeking votes in support of NDA candidate Yasodha Devi. Marandi in his rallies has attacked the State government over corruption and loot of state mineral resources.

Marandi said that the present government has looted the state for the last three and a half years. Mines, minerals, land and sand stones have all been looted. Such a looter government needs to be thrown out of the state.

Marandi also raised the collapsed law and order situation of the state, stating that criminals in the state are unbridled. Incidents of murder, loot, theft, robbery, kidnapping have become common. Rape incidents are happening everyday. Daughters are being murdered, criminals are burning daughters with petrol.

He said that all this is happening because the present regime has engaged the state police not to restore law and order but to recover money.

Jharkhand unit of opposition I.N.D.I.A too has jointly campaigned for the Dumri by-poll to ensure the victory of its candidate. victory of its candidate, sources in it said on Saturday.

Jharkhand chief minister Hemant Soren appealed the voters to ensure the victory for the ruling alliance in the upcoming Dumri assembly bypoll as a tribute to former ministers and Jharkhand Mukti Morcha (JMM) leaders late Jagarnath Mahto and late Haji Hussain Ansari.

The chief minister had said the opposition in the state was attempting to win the election with money power and by creating divisions in society.

“During the Covid-19 pandemic, there was a general call for everyone to stay locked indoors. However, along with our ministers, we ensured that no poor person died of hunger, as many people in this state earn their livelihood daily. Two of our ministers were martyred due to Covid-19. Our senior minister, Haji Hussain Ansari, who was 75 years old, lost his life fighting the coronavirus. We paid tribute to him by appointing his son as a minister even before he became an MLA,” said Soren while addressing a rally at Dumri.

“Today is not the right day to count the achievements of my government. It’s time to pay tribute to Jagarnath Mahto, who lost his life serving the people despite the challenges posed by Covid-19. I have done my part by appointing Bebi Devi (his wife) as a minister. Now it’s your turn to pay tribute on September 5 (voting day),” Soren had also said.

Apart from these the seat also witnessed the entry of AIMIM. Slogans of Pakistan Zindabad were raised at the rallies. AIMIM candidate for Dumri by-election was booked for alleged 'pro-Pakistan' slogan raised during the party chief Asaduddin Owaisi's public rally in Giridih district.

Dumri Block Development Officer (BDO), Anwesha Ona, who is also a member of the flying squad, had said that the alleged video footage was examined with the footage of their videographers’ team before lodging the FIR. "Now police will take action accordingly," she said.

The AIMIM Jharkhand president Md Shakir, however, refuted the allegation terming it a "tampered video".

The polling for the by-election to the Dumri assembly constituency will be held on September 5, and the votes will be counted on September 8.

The by-election was necessitated due to the death of JMM MLA Jagarnath Mahto, the former education minister, in April. The JMM has fielded Mahto's wife Bebi Devi as the candidate of the INDIA bloc, while the AJSU Party has nominated Yashoda Devi as the NDA candidate.

In the 2019 assembly elections, Mahto defeated AJSU Party's Yashoda Devi by a margin of 34,288 votes. AIMIM's Rizvi was in the fourth position with 24,132 votes.
